An approach to develop component-based control software for flexible manufacturing systems

被引:0
|
作者
Morton, YT [1 ]
Troy, DA [1 ]
Pizza, GA [1 ]
机构
[1] Miami Univ, Dept Mfg Engn, Oxford, OH 45056 USA
关键词
D O I
暂无
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
In recent years, component-based software engineering has emerged as an approach for creating control software for flexible manufacturing systems (FMS). This paper presents a state-based approach to model software components as building blocks for flexible manufacturing control software. The general framework developed by Adiga and Cogez (1993) for modeling object-oriented manufacturing software is extended to component-oriented modeling. General approaches in developing state models, control logic, and interface components are presented. Software components that simulate sensors and control activities of the work cell were also created. The simulated components can interact with or replace real system components for planning, debugging, and testing purposes. These software components can be used to create control software using visual design tools with no coding, and can be configured during both design and run time. Great emphasis has been placed on the generic features, reusability, case of use, and case of maintenance in the design of the software components. We implemented our software components in Java and tested our design and implementation using the Miami University Computer Integrated Manufacturing Laboratory FMS work cell. The benefits of the design were fully demonstrated through experiments at Miami.
引用
收藏
页码:4708 / 4713
页数:6
相关论文
共 50 条
  • [1] A state-based modelling approach to develop component-based control software for flexible manufacturing systems
    Morton, YT
    Troy, DA
    Pizza, GA
    INTERNATIONAL JOURNAL OF COMPUTER INTEGRATED MANUFACTURING, 2003, 16 (4-5) : 292 - 306
  • [2] Model-driven, component-based approach to reconfiguring manufacturing software systems
    Weston, R
    INTERNATIONAL JOURNAL OF OPERATIONS & PRODUCTION MANAGEMENT, 1999, 19 (08) : 834 - 855
  • [3] Model-integrating development of software systems: a flexible component-based approach
    Mahdi Derakhshanmanesh
    Jürgen Ebert
    Marvin Grieger
    Gregor Engels
    Software & Systems Modeling, 2019, 18 : 2557 - 2586
  • [4] Model-integrating development of software systems: a flexible component-based approach
    Derakhshanmanesh, Mahdi
    Ebert, Juergen
    Grieger, Marvin
    Engels, Gregor
    SOFTWARE AND SYSTEMS MODELING, 2019, 18 (04): : 2557 - 2586
  • [5] A holonic component-based approach to reconfigurable manufacturing control architecture
    Chirn, JL
    McFarlane, DC
    11TH INTERNATIONAL WORKSHOP ON DATABASE AND EXPERT SYSTEMS APPLICATION, PROCEEDINGS, 2000, : 219 - 223
  • [6] A combined component-based approach for the design of distributed software systems
    de Farias, CRG
    Pires, LF
    van Sinderen, M
    Quartel, D
    EIGHTH IEEE WORKSHOP ON FUTURE TRENDS OF DISTRIBUTED COMPUTING SYSTEMS, PROCEEDINGS, 2001, : 2 - 8
  • [7] A COMPONENT-BASED APPROACH FOR MANUFACTURING SIMULATION
    Riddick, Frank
    Kibira, Deogratis
    Lee, Y. Tina
    Balakirsky, Stephen
    EMERGING M&S APPLICATIONS IN INDUSTRY & ACADEMIA SYMPOSIUM 2011 (EAIA 2011) - 2011 SPRING SIMULATION MULTICONFERENCE - BK 5 OF 8, 2011, : 54 - 61
  • [8] An approach for Component-based Software Composition
    Miguel Gomez, Juan
    Alor-Hernandez, Giner
    Posada-Gomez, Ruben
    Rivera, Ismael
    Mencke, Myriam
    Chamizo, Javier
    Garcia Sanchez, Francisco
    Toma, Ioan
    CERMA 2008: ELECTRONICS, ROBOTICS AND AUTOMOTIVE MECHANICS CONFERENCE, PROCEEDINGS, 2008, : 195 - +
  • [9] A component-based approach to telecommunication software
    Zave, P
    Jackson, M
    IEEE SOFTWARE, 1998, 15 (05) : 70 - +
  • [10] Hierarchical model to develop component-based systems
    Amirat, Abdelkrim
    Oussalah, Mourad
    FIFTEENTH IEEE INTERNATIONAL CONFERENCE AND WORKSHOPS ON THE ENGINEERING OF COMPUTER-BASED SYSTEMS, PROCEEDINGS, 2008, : 337 - 345